Abstract
In this paper, load impedance design methods for a multi-terminal dipole antenna are investigated to achieve high efficiency antenna. A load network satisfying the Hermitian match can maximize received power. However, the implementation of Hermitian matching network requires huge complexity and it causes losses and noise in the network. We proposed the different matching network which can achieve simple load circuit. Based on the computer simulations, the comparisons between the proposed matching network and Hermitian matching network is shown.
